> after the Update to V. 1.1.2 and Client V. 1.3.9 the following script doesn´t work:
>
> <?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
>
> <packages>
>
> <package id="wpkglog" name="wpkg.xml files from workstations" revision="1" priority="0" execute="always">
>         <install timeout="15" cmd='cmd /C copy /Y 
> "%SYSTEMROOT%\system32\wpkg.xml" 
> "\\server\hostlogs\%COMPUTERNAME%-wpkg.xml"' /> </package> </packages>
>
> I get these error:
>
> Could not process (install) package 'wpkg.xml files from workstations' (wpkglog):
> Exit code returned non-successful value (1) on command 'cmd /C copy /Y 
> "%SYSTEMROOT%\system32\wpkg.xml" "\\server5\hostlogs\%COMPUTERNAME%-
> wpkg.xml"'.
> Can you helb me to solve the problem?
>>

>>I have changed to run this as a batch script as "Execute After" from the WPKG client, which makes sure that the file is not in use by wpkg.js
